Position Summary:

 

To provide individual and family therapy for children, adults and their families according to intervention strategies approved by Agape Network and Medicaid.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

 

  1. Maintain clinical files by filing paperwork no less than bi-weekly and ensuring that all paperwork is completed in a timely fashion.
  2. Provide individual counseling to assigned caseload on a weekly basis.
  3. Facilitate group therapy sessions if and when deemed necessary.
  4. Complete all clinical assessments and paperwork such as Biopsychosocial, Master Treatment Plans, Treatment Plan reviews, and ancillary documentation within 48 hours of contact with clients.
  5. Complete state reporting documents, Therapy Notes, CFARS/FARS (admission, 6 months, discharge). MHO’s (admission, quarterly, discharge). ASAM’s (admission, monthly, discharge).
  6. Complete prior authorizations for all clients prior to administering clinical services. Resubmit prior authorizations prior to the date requested by the insurance companies.
  7. Complete progress notes within 48 hours of face-to-face contact.
  8. Submit progress notes every 48 hours from the date services are rendered.
  9. Monitor and track units approved by the insurance company.
  10. Attend monthly meetings when deemed necessary
  11. When appropriate renew state license and registered intern status with the Department of Health.
  12. Comply with AHCA stipulations for TBOS and individual therapists.
  13. Ensure that Medicaid is active, and the insurance provided has not changed at the beginning of each month.
  14. Maintain a valid Florida Driver’s License and car insurance.
  15. Be a facilitator between the Agape Staff and client.
  16. Maintain productivity at 85% of caseload.
  17. Attend supervision weekly, biweekly, monthly contingent on recommendation from Lead Therapist to no less than 1 time per month.
  18. Complete compliance training as needed to comply with licensure and DCF licensing (Relias Training)
  19. Check email communication daily.
  20. Perform other duties assigned by Outpatient Lead Therapist, Outpatient Therapist Supervisor and others.


 

Qualifications: The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ill and/or ability required. 

 

Education and/or Experience: Master’s degree in Marriage and Family Therapy, Mental Health Counseling, or Social Work, plus one-year experience working with severely emotionally disturbed individuals served or individuals with co-occurring disorders. Must have Registered intern status in the state of Florida in Mental Health/Social Work/ or Marriage and Family Counseling. Computer skills are essential.
